Le Potazzine Gorelli Rosso di Montalcino, Tuscany, Italy 2023

Le Potazzine is a true family affair, founded by Gigliola Giannetti in 1993, and which she now runs with her daughters, Viola and Sofia. Potazzine is local dialect for the “little birds” which adorn the label, as well as a term for children. The estate has just five hectares of vines, among the highest plots in Montalcino at 570 metres. The cool sites produce remarkably elegant Sangiovese, and Gigliola’s Brunellos retain freshness in even the hottest years. It’s an estate destined for greatness.
"The Le Potazzine 2023 Rosso di Montalcino shows attractive aromas of dried pomegranate, grenadine and fresh iris root. The bouquet encapsulates the pretty fresh and fruit-forward aromas inherent to Sangiovese. I love the lively and food-friendly personality of this pretty wine that ages in Slavonian oak casks for a brief 10 months. This is one of the better Rossos from this vintage." Wine Advocate 90
